Dick's Sporting Goods - About the company

Dick's Sporting Goods is a public company based in Pittsburgh (United States), founded in 1948. It operates as a Retailer of sports goods and accessories. Dick's Sporting Goods has raised an undisclosed amount in funding. The company has 20 active competitors, including 13 that have exited. Its top competitors include companies like Hibbett, Foot Locker and Quiksilver.

Company Details

Dick's Sporting Goods is the retailer of sporting goods, offering a broad assortment of brand name sporting goods equipment, apparel, and footwear. It has 610 stores in 47 states. It also runs specialty chains like Golf Galaxy, True Runner and Field Stream. In 2022, the company recorded annual revenues of $12.37B and a net profit of $1.04B.
